Jimmie Johnson Triumphs at Dover: NASCAR

On Sunday, the four-time defending Sprint Cup champion, Jimmie Johnson, won the Dover AAA 400, the second leg of the Chase for the Sprint Cup. Andy Schlek and Stuart O’Grady Sent Home from Spanish Vuelta: Cycling News

On Tuesday, Andy Schlek, who has been runner up in the Tour de France twice, and Stuart O’Grady, his Saxo Bank teammate were both sent home from the Spanish Vuelta for drinking, which is against team rules and regulations. IndyCar – IRL Kentucky Indy 300 Race Preview

This coming Saturday, the IRL Kentucky 300 at the Kentucky Speedway will feature a classic points battle between road race expert Will Power and defending IRL champ Dario Franchitti.
